IIHF approves bid to increase number of teams at 2019 Women’s World Championships
The number of teams competing at the 2019 World Championships will grow from eight to ten after a unanimous vote at the IIHF council meeting.
Furies Forward Kelly Terry Announces Retirement
Toronto Furies star forward Kelly Terry announced her retirement from the CWHL and hockey today on her personal twitter and instagram accounts. She is 24-years-old and will be turning 25 in June.
